No Two Are the Same

Your loved ones are unique, which means that their final resting place should be too. With marble urns, no two are the same. Marble is a gorgeous stone that is formed when limestone metamorphoses due to either heat or pressure. This process occurs below the earth's surface. This makes marble designs random and unique, without the influence of humans. Along with design, marble urns also come in a variety of shapes and sizes. This way, there is a perfect marble urn to fit the characteristics and personality of your loved one.
